3-bromo-3-methylthiolane 1,1-dioxide
Also Known As: 3-bromo-3-methyltetrahydrothiophene 1,1-dioxide, 3-bromo-3-methylthiolane-1,1-dione, 3-bromo-3-methylthiolane 1,1-dioxide, 3-bromo-3-methyl-thiolane 1,1-dioxide, 3-bromo-3-methyl-tetrahydro-thiophene-1,1-dioxide
| Molecular Formula | C5H9BrO2S |
| Molecular Weight | 211.95065 g/mol |
| XLogP | 0.7 |
| Topological Polar Surface Area (TPSA) | 42.5 Ų |
| Hydrogen Bond Donors | 0 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 0 |
| Exact Mass | 211.95065 Da |
| Heavy Atoms | 9 |
| Complexity | 203.0 |
| SMILES | CC1(CCS(=O)(=O)C1)Br |
| InChIKey | DMCRORNOBOZTAR-UHFFFAOYSA-N |
The XLogP value of 0.7 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 3-Bromo-3-methyltetrahydrothiophene 1,1-dioxide. With a topological polar surface area (TPSA) of 42.5 Ų, 3-Bromo-3-methyltetrahydrothiophene 1,1-dioxide ex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 3-Bromo-3-methyltetrahydrothiophene 1,1-dioxide has 0 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
